I’m sorry, I probably talked way too much in this video… but it’s very hard for me to not get overly excited on this topic 🤣
Plants that have amazing leaves are one if my garden weaknesses - I just cant resist a plant that looks good without blooms for the majority of the season - so I have crammed as many japanese maples as I can in my Atlanta suburban garden.
In this video I share:
🍁A full tour of my Japanese maple collection
🍁 how to plant japanese maples
🍁 tips for japanese maple success
🍁 how to move japanese maples
🍁 japanese maple care tips
